You will be expected to:

Contribute to the preparation of HSE Plans and safe work methods, and ensure that both are carried out effectively.

Identify HSE risks and dangers and contribute appropriate preventative measures in the method statements.

Prepare HSE audit and assessment plans.

Evaluate the performance of subcontractors and determine their suitability for future projects.

Ensure toolbox meetings are held regularly by supervisors and foremen.

Issue HSE corrective action reports and hold inspections to verify satisfactory resolutions of follow up actions.

Organise regular meetings with subcontractors to review progress and propose actions to deal with any non-conformity.

Perform HSE audits on the compliance of supervisors, foremen, subcontractors and applicable suppliers.

Monthly equipment inspections.

Perform HSE test activities.

Act as a coordinator for the investigation of accidents and ensure that all reporting is in accordance with the Project HSE Plan.
